Can a Physiotherapist Help My Pelvic Floor?

Yes, A Physiotherapist can help your pelvic floor.

It is estimated that 1 in 3 women will suffer from pelvic dysfunction in their lifetime. However, a physiotherapist can help you with a non-invasive treatment plan to address your problem.

The pelvic floor consists of muscles that support the urinary and reproductive tracts and control the bladder and bowels. A dysfunction in one of the muscles can result in pain and discomfort. However, a physiotherapist can help you assess and treat your low back pain, incontinence, constipation, etc., using a personalized therapeutic plan that best suit your needs because no situation is the same.

Our treatment involves pelvic floor muscle exercises, acupuncture, biofeedback and muscle stimulation, pilates for pregnancy and postnatally, perineal and scar massage, and other therapeutic techniques.

WHAT HAPPENS ON YOUR VISIT TO A PELVIC FLOOR PHYSIOTHERAPY SESSION?

Physiotherapy treatment for women can include different techniques and exercises, but your comfort is our priority. We will perform a physical examination on you to know the source of your problem. We will give you extensive education regarding bowel and bladder function, how they work, how to relax your muscles, and how to restrain the bowel and bladder, as well as fluid and fiber intake. We will also give you instructions on abdominal massage and other manual techniques to assist in creating success in the treatment program. Treatment may vary depending on the source of your problems and symptoms, as each treatment is tailored specifically to meet your needs.
